Cruising in Company begins – at last!

Cruise to Island Harbour and the Hamble.

On Monday 12th April seven CYC yachts set off, freshly released by the latest COVID roadmap step. This was the first CYC Yacht Section cruise of the year. Our first destination was Cowes Yacht Haven. A north-north-westerly wind enabled us to have a very pleasant sail down the harbour and on to Cowes without a tack. In Cowes we were able to engage in non-essential shopping for the first time for a long time and noted a long queue for the barber. In the evening we had our first out-door get-together of the year. We kept strictly to the Covid regulations by having evening drinks in groups of four or six in different cockpits.

On Tuesday we had a leisurely motor up the Medina to Island Harbour where Christian made us welcome. Those who wished to, walked up to Newport and back in the afternoon, stopping for outdoor tea and cake, and in the evening, we all dined at The Breeze Restaurant, who were very glad to see the return of customers. I was able to make my first visit of the year to the excellent chandlers there and made good use of the boatyard who replaced a broken throttle cable for us.

We had a gentle sail to Port Hamble on Wednesday in the sun but with little wind. We had another evening of drinks in cockpits before most, if not all, of us eat on board.

For the return to Chichester we had a brisk east-north-east wind which enabled us to sail down to the forts and then tack our way to the harbour entrance. It was a sunny but chilly sail. Bugsy 2, Firedragon, Windreaver, Canopus, Raven and Dawn Chorus welcomed Lunici on their first CYC cruise.
